KeyCorp Increases T-Mobile US (NASDAQ:TMUS) Price Target to $185.00

T-Mobile US (NASDAQ:TMUSGet Free Report) had its price target upped by KeyCorp from $175.00 to $185.00 in a research note issued to investors on Friday, Benzinga reports. The firm currently has an “overweight” rating on the Wireless communications provider’s stock. KeyCorp’s price objective indicates a potential upside of 12.83% from the stock’s previous close.

T-Mobile US Price Performance

TMUS stock opened at $163.96 on Friday. T-Mobile US has a 1 year low of $124.92 and a 1 year high of $168.64.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 1.18, a quick ratio of 0.83 and a current ratio of 0.91. The stock’s 50 day moving average price is $162.51 and its 200 day moving average price is $157.08. The firm has a market cap of $194.60 billion, a P/E ratio of 22.31, a PEG ratio of 0.68 and a beta of 0.49.

T-Mobile US (NASDAQ:TMUSGet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ings results on Thursday, April 25th. The Wireless communications provider reported $2.00 earnings per share for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$1.83 by $0.17. T-Mobile US had a return on equity of 13.45% and a net margin of 11.15%. The company had revenue of $19.59 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$19.81 billion. During the same quarter in the prior year, the company posted $1.58 EPS. The business’s revenue for the quarter was down .2% compared to the same quarter last year. On average, sell-side analysts expect that T-Mobile US will post 8.83 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

About T-Mobile US

T-Mobile US, Inc, together with its subsidiaries, provides mobile communications services in the United States, Puerto Rico, and the United States Virgin Islands. The company offers voice, messaging, and data services to customers in the postpaid, prepaid, and wholesale and other services. It also provides wireless devices, including smartphones, wearables, tablets, home broadband routers, and other mobile communication devices, as well as wireless devices and accessories; financing through equipment installment plans; reinsurance for device insurance policies and extended warranty contracts; leasing through JUMP! On Demand; and High Speed Internet services.
